What pressure is exerted by a person on one leg weighing 55 kg with a leg size of 202 cm3

To find out the pressure exerted by the person represented, consider the formula: Px = Ft / Sop = mh * g / Sn, where mh is the mass of the person represented (mh = 55 kg); g – acceleration due to gravity (g ≈ 9.8 m / s2); Sн – support leg area (Sн = 202 cm2 = 202 * 10 ^ -4 m2).

Let’s perform the calculation: Px = mh * g / Sn = 55 * 9.8 / (202 * 10 ^ -4) ≈ 26.7 * 10 ^ 3 Pa.

Answer: The design pressure exerted by the person represented is 26.7 kPa.
